GCKSessionTraits 类

GCKSessionTraits 类参考

概览

一个描述会话的特征和功能的对象。

开始时间
3.0

继承 NSObject、<NSCopy> 和 <NSSecureCoding>。

实例方法摘要

(instancetype) - initWithMinimumVolume:maximumVolume:volumeIncrement:supportsMuting:
 指定的初始化程序。更多...
 
(instancetype) - init
 便捷初始化程序。更多...
 
(BOOL) - isFixedVolume
 这是否为固定音量设备。更多...
 

属性摘要

float minimumVolume
 最小音量值。更多...
 
float maximumVolume
 最大音量值。更多...
 
float volumeIncrement
 用于调高/调低音量的音量增量。更多...
 
BOOL supportsMuting
 音频是否可以静音。更多...
 

方法详细信息

- (instancetype) initWithMinimumVolume: (float)  minimumVolume
maximumVolume: (float)  maximumVolume
volumeIncrement: (float)  volumeIncrement
supportsMuting: (BOOL)  supportsMuting 

指定的初始化程序。

- (instancetype) init

便捷初始化程序。

将音量范围设置为 [0.0, 1.0],将音量增量设置为 0.05 (5%),并将 supportedMuting 标志设置为 YES

- (BOOL) isFixedVolume

这是否为固定音量设备。

房源详情

- (float) minimumVolume
readnonatomicassign

最小音量值。

必须是非负数,并且小于或等于最大音量。

- (float) maximumVolume
readnonatomicassign

最大音量值。

必须是非负数,并且大于或等于最小音量。

- (float) volumeIncrement
readnonatomicassign

用于调高/调低音量的音量增量。

可能会为 0,表示音量是固定的。必须是非负数,并且小于或等于最大音量和最小音量之间的差值。

- (BOOL) supportsMuting
readnonatomicassign

音频是否可以静音。